AI Generated Summary: Conversation with Chris LissAI Generated Summary: Conversation with Chris Liss

In this episode, hosts discuss with guest Chris Liss, former Rotowire owner and podcaster, his journey into Bitcoin, Nostr, and value-for-value content models like zapping on Stacker News. They explore challenges in onboarding non-tech-savvy users to lightning payments, contrasting it with subscription services and prediction markets like Polymarket. The conversation shifts to sports, including fantasy football strategies (e.g., stacking the 49ers for a league win), paddle tennis anecdotes, and hypotheticals like hiding in pro sports or cloning NBA players (e.g., five LeBrons vs. five Currys).

Random topics include New York sports fandom correlations (Mets/Jets vs. Yankees/Giants), Eli Manning's Hall of Fame case (two Super Bowls vs. mediocre stats), Shador Sanders' draft fall, the 49ers' injury woes possibly linked to EMF from a nearby substation (with calls for mitigation), a bizarre skiing controversy involving performance-enhancing injections for suit aerodynamics, and NBA trends like aging stars dominating drafts and potential cell phone impacts on younger players' development. The episode ends on NFL quarterback classes and optimism for teams like the Giants.
